Members of the UN Security Council express concern over possibility of full-scale conflict following assassination of Haniyeh in Iran | Updates on Israel-Palestine tensions


Countries at the United Nations Security Council (UNSC) have united to condemn the assassination of Hamas’s political chief Ismail Haniyeh in Iran and have called for diplomatic efforts to prevent a potential all-out war in the Middle East. The emergency meeting of the UNSC came amidst escalating tensions in the region, with Iran and Hamas holding Israel responsible for the attack on Haniyeh in Tehran.

The assassination of Haniyeh followed the killing of Hezbollah’s top military commander Fuad Shukr by Israel in Beirut. The attack was claimed to be in retaliation for a rocket assault in the Israeli-occupied Golan Heights that caused the death of 12 children and young people from the Druze community.

Various UNSC member countries have spoken out against the escalating violence, with Palestine calling for international intervention to prevent Israel from plunging the Middle East into chaos. Iran has also condemned Israel and called for sanctions to be imposed on the country.

The United States denied any involvement in the attacks and emphasized the need to prevent a broader war. Israel urged the UNSC to condemn Iran for its alleged support of terrorism and Hezbollah. However, Lebanon and Syria dismissed these claims and accused Israel of aggression.

China, Russia, and Japan have called for a ceasefire and increased diplomatic efforts to prevent further escalation of the conflict. France and the United Kingdom have also stressed the need for peace talks and a two-state solution in the region.

The assassination of Haniyeh has sparked fears of a potential all-out war in the Middle East, with countries at the UNSC urging for immediate action to de-escalate tensions and prevent further bloodshed.
